What You Can Expect on the Tour

Stop 1: Cenote Cristalino

The first stop is Cenote Cristalino, famous for its crystal-clear waters that make it a perfect swimming and snorkeling spot. Known for its accessibility and stunning clarity, this cenote is ideal for all ages and swimming abilities. We loved the way the sunlight filters through the open top, illuminating the water and creating a dreamlike atmosphere. You’ll have about an hour and ten minutes here, giving ample time to float, swim, or just relax on the banks.

One thing to note: the admission fee is included, so no surprises or extra costs. As several reviews highlight, visitors appreciate the ease of access and cleanliness, making it a comfortable first stop.

Stop 2: Cenote Jardín del Eden

Next, you’ll head to Cenote Jardín del Eden, which lives up to its lush name. Surrounded by dense greenery and towering stalactites, this large open-air cenote feels more untamed and rugged. It’s a bit wilder than Cristalino, with plenty of nooks to explore and snorkel through. Here, you can get a closer look at the stalactites hanging from the ceiling and enjoy a more natural, less manicured environment.

Snorkeling here is lively, with clearer waters and more adventure, lasting about 1 hour and 10 minutes. The region’s eco-conscious approach means you’ll be encouraged to interact respectfully with the environment. Reviewers often mention the beautiful views and how peaceful this spot feels compared to busy tours.

Stop 3: La Cueva del Pescador and Lunch in Akumal

The final part of your adventure is a delicious Mexican lunch at La Cueva del Pescador in Akumal. This charming eatery is beloved for its fresh seafood and relaxed, authentic atmosphere. After a morning of swimming and snorkeling, you’ll appreciate sitting down for regional flavors and discussing the morning’s highlights.

The lunch lasts about 1 hour and 30 minutes, giving you a good break before heading home. The included snacks and iced drinks keep everyone energized and refreshed. Many reviews praise this meal as a highlight—simple, tasty, and genuine.

What’s Included and What to Consider

Dos Cenotes and Restaurant Lunch Private Adventure - What’s Included and What to Consider

This tour provides excellent value with everything from admission fees and snorkeling gear to private air-conditioned transportation. The snorkeling equipment is high-quality but deliberately minimal—no fins—so that you can better respect the delicate marine ecosystems.

The private transportation makes the experience comfortable and stress-free, especially if you’re staying outside Playa del Carmen or in a nearby hotel. Plus, snacks and drinks in the van keep you energized throughout the day.

Not included are gratuities, which are customary but optional, and any additional expenses like souvenirs or extra food beyond the provided lunch.

FAQ

Dos Cenotes and Restaurant Lunch Private Adventure - FAQ

Is the tour suitable for all ages?
Most travelers can participate, and the stops are generally accessible for a variety of ages. However, the tour duration and activity level might be best suited for those able to handle a few hours of swimming and walking.

Are admission fees included?
Yes, all necessary admission fees are covered, so you won’t need to worry about extra costs at the cenotes.

Is snorkeling equipment provided?
Yes, high-quality masks, snorkel tubes, and life jackets are included. Fins are not provided to minimize environmental impact.

How is transportation arranged?
You’ll ride in a private, air-conditioned van from your location in Playa del Carmen, making the trip comfortable and convenient.

What’s the meal like?
The lunch is a regional Mexican meal at La Cueva del Pescador, known for its fresh seafood and relaxed atmosphere. It’s a good chance to unwind and enjoy local flavors.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, cancellations up to 24 hours in advance are eligible for a full refund, providing some flexibility.

Are snacks and drinks provided during the tour?
Yes, snacks and iced drinks are available in the van to keep you energized throughout the day.
